Kindness of Anonymous friends
My mother is a sixty year old widow taking care of her invalid daughter by herself. Not only that, but she does so many things for others always putting herself last. She has a hard time making ends meet so when the van she drives broke down we were worried how to pay for the $2,000 bill. My mom desperately needs the van because of the wheelchair lift so there was no question we had to get the money somehow. The van had actually broke down on the way to the hopsital, since my sister was ill during this time. THings were just going from bad to worse. Everyone was worried about the money and my other sister and I were pooling our funds to help out the best we could. My mom had called and told me she would come by to pick up the money so I was suprised when she called back and told me she didn’t need it after all. She had called the repairshop and they told my mom that the bill had been paid in full. Confused, my mom said you must be mistaken and asked who paid the bill. She was told it was an anonymous person who wanted to help and asked their name be withheld. My mom was sobbing telling me this story, she was so touched by the anonymous friend’s generosity and kindness. We still do not know who generously paid such a bill, but their love and kindness will never be forgotten.
